The interplay between tradition and modernity has emerged as a pressing global concern in the age of pluralism. This captivating book delves into the intricate relationship between traditional Dai culture and modern school education through a comprehensive field study conducted in the picturesque Dai region of Xishuangbanna, Yunnan, China. The study employs a multi-faceted approach to analyze the underlying reasons for conflicts that arise between monastic education and modern school education in this region. It also explores the profound logic behind the formation of the Dai people's belief in Southern Theravada Buddhism, which holds a significant place in Dai culture. By examining the transformative effects of the modern school system on monastic education, the study uncovers a fascinating symbiosis in the differences and conflicts between these two educational forms.
Through a detailed examination of the changes that have taken place in monastic education before and after its interaction with the modern school system, the study identifies a harmonious coexistence of contrasts. The author then presents a groundbreaking symbiosis theory of multiple educational forms in ethnic areas, offering targeted solutions to address specific challenges faced by Dai monastic education and modern school education in Xishuangbanna.
This book is a treasure trove for students and scholars of Chinese studies, ethnic studies, education, and anyone with a keen interest in exploring the complexities of multi-ethnic issues. It provides valuable insights into the rich tapestry of traditions and modernizations, shedding light on the ways in which societies can navigate the challenges of change while preserving their cultural heritage.
